Ticket: Missed pick-up — sealed-bid tender documents, Halvett Depot. The scheduled collection for the Orrinvale tender packet did not occur during the Tuesday window; the sealed envelope remains in the secure cage, untouched and logged. Submission deadline pressure means a re-run must happen tomorrow morning without fail. Please prepare the packet for release and follow the hand-over instruction below.

courier memo of yawep-yafog: the pramir ulaix courier leaves the ulavan aldix frair zorok oliiel joreth rusdor fenvan ledger at gate 1305 under passcode 514738

### Checklist: Verify parcel-tracking webhook — Driftbox Courier

Before release, confirm the Driftbox parcel-tracking webhook accepts a signed test event and returns 200 within 2 seconds. Use the staging sender in the Mallow console; do not point it at production carriers. Check that retry backoff caps at five attempts and that duplicate delivery events are deduplicated by sequence number. New team members: ask your onboarding buddy to watch your first run. Record the staging build token from the console output below.

pipeline stamp: htk3_69f

Subject: Winding down the Larkspur line

Hi all — and a warm welcome to our incoming director. As flagged at the offsite, we're moving ahead with retiring the Larkspur product line by end of next fiscal year. Demand has drifted to the Meridell range, and keeping both alive is eating support capacity. Customer comms go out in phases; Tomas is drafting the migration offer. Expect a few noisy accounts in the Calderbay region, but nothing we can't manage. The confidential plan behind this decision follows below.

internal memo for kagef-tahof: Kasixek Foods plans to lower the Kasix list price by 31 percent in February.

Account recovery — StageGrid seat-map renderer. When a venue admin is locked out, verify their booking-office callback first. Then open the StageGrid recovery console, select the affected venue, and choose "restore admin". The console will prompt once for the recovery passphrase; enter it carefully, as three failures freeze the account. The passphrase follows below.

vault phrase of bagaf-kajeg = jorath-feniel-briir-siliel-ralix